Table 461: Packet Interface Read <strong>and</strong> Clear Counters Test (#887) 4 of 4<br />

Error<br />

Code<br />

1024–<br />

1096<br />

Test<br />

Result<br />

FAIL Firmware problem.<br />

1. This may be the result of old firmware not supporting new<br />

software operation. Verify the IPSI circuit pack’s firmware vintage<br />

<strong>and</strong> download the new firmware if appropriate.<br />

2. The firmware image on the IPSI circuit pack may have been<br />

corrupted. Download the firmware image.<br />

3. Retry the comm<strong>and</strong>.<br />

4. If the same Error Code occurs:<br />

The st<strong>and</strong>by IPSI’s Packet Interface module has bad<br />

translation RAM locations. A MINOR alarm is generated<br />

when the number of bad locations is between 1 <strong>and</strong> 4. A<br />

MAJOR alarm is generated if the number of bad locations is<br />

5 or more. The MAJOR alarm prevents a pled IPSI<br />

interchange (scheduled or on-dem<strong>and</strong>).<br />

If a MAJOR alarm is associated with this <strong>error</strong>, replace the<br />

alarmed st<strong>and</strong>by IPSI circuit pack.<br />

If a MINOR alarm is associated with this <strong>error</strong>, replace the<br />

alarmed st<strong>and</strong>by IPSI circuit pack at a time that would cause<br />

the least disruption to service.<br />

PASS The server can communicate with the IPSI circuit pack’s Packet<br />

Interface module.<br />

1. If problems are still reported on the Packet Interface, check for<br />

failures using the Packet Interface Private Looparound Test<br />

(#885) <strong>and</strong> Packet Interface Maintenance Looparound Test<br />

(#886).<br />

NO<br />

BOARD<br />

Description / Recommendation<br />

The IPSI circuit pack’s Packet Interface module is administered, but is<br />

not detected as physically present.<br />

1. If the IPSI circuit pack is present, replace it.<br />

2. If the IPSI circuit pack is not present, insert a TN2312AP IPSI<br />

circuit pack in the administered slot, <strong>and</strong> rerun the <strong>test</strong>.<br />
